You may wonder why your solar system shuts off when the grid goes down. During power outages, the utility grid also mandates solar systems to turn off. This prevents the ability of your solar system to feed power to the grid and to your home/business. A solar storage battery system can automatically isolate your solar system from the grid and will keep your family and business up and running.

Why Backup Power Matters More Than Ever

Power outages are becoming more frequent, longer-lasting, and more dangerous.

In September 2024, Hurricane Helene left over 1.6 million homes in Florida and 1.3 million in South Carolina without electricity — some for over a week.a

In January 2025, utility-initiated shutoffs during the California wildfires impacted more than 400,000 customers, disrupting lives and businesses across the state.b

And in February 2021, a historic winter storm in Texas caused 14.5 million people to lose power — contributing to over 700 deaths.c

These extreme events are no longer rare. Losing power for even a few hours can quickly become a serious risk. According to the FDA, refrigerated food can spoil in just 4 hours during an outage, and frozen food may not last more than 24–48 hours without a properly functioning freezer. Beyond food loss, lack of power can affect access to water, heating, medical equipment, and communications — all critical for safety and wellbeing.d

This is required by utility regulations. When the grid goes down, solar systems are mandated to shut off automatically to prevent backfeeding electricity onto downed lines, which could endanger utility workers. A battery storage system solves this by creating an energy island — isolating your solar system from the grid so it can continue generating and storing power for your home even during an outage.

Fortress Power battery systems switch over automatically in milliseconds — fast enough that most appliances and electronics don't even register the interruption. Unlike a generator, which requires manual startup and can take minutes to come online, a battery system is always on standby and responds instantly the moment grid power is lost.

No. Fortress Power battery systems can be charged directly from the grid, making them useful for backup power even without solar panels. That said, pairing a battery system with solar panels maximizes your energy independence — your panels can recharge your battery during an outage, extending backup duration significantly. Many homeowners start with a battery-only system and add solar later.

Yes. Lithium Iron Phosphate (LFP) is the safest lithium battery chemistry available for home energy storage. Unlike NMC (nickel manganese cobalt) batteries used in some competitor products, LFP cells are thermally and chemically stable — they do not experience thermal runaway, which eliminates the risk of fire or explosion under normal operating conditions. Fortress Power uses LFP exclusively across its entire residential and commercial product line.
